/*
* Test program for posix_spawn() and posix_spawnp() as specified by
* IEEE Std. 1003.1-2008.
*/
#include <sys/cdefs.h>
__FBSDID("$FreeBSD$");
#include <sys/wait.h>
#include <assert.h>
#include <errno.h>
#include <stdio.h>
#include <stdlib.h>
#include <string.h>
#include <spawn.h>
int
main(int argc, char *argv[])
{
int error, status;
pid_t pid, waitres;
char *myargs[4];
char *myenv[2] = { "answer=42", NULL };
/* Make sure we have no child processes. */
while (waitpid(-1, NULL, 0) != -1)
;
assert(errno == ECHILD);
/* Simple test. */
myargs[0] = "sh";
myargs[1] = "-c";
myargs[2] = "exit $answer";
myargs[3] = NULL;
error = posix_spawnp(&pid, myargs[0], NULL, NULL, myargs, myenv);
assert(error == 0);
waitres = waitpid(pid, &status, 0);
assert(waitres == pid);
assert(WIFEXITED(status) && WEXITSTATUS(status) == 42);
/*
* If the executable does not exist, the function shall either fail
* and not create a child process or succeed and create a child
* process that exits with status 127.
*/
myargs[0] = "/var/empty/nonexistent";
myargs[1] = NULL;
error = posix_spawn(&pid, myargs[0], NULL, NULL, myargs, myenv);
if (error == 0) {
waitres = waitpid(pid, &status, 0);
assert(waitres == pid);
assert(WIFEXITED(status) && WEXITSTATUS(status) == 127);
} else {
assert(error == ENOENT);
waitres = waitpid(-1, NULL, 0);
assert(waitres == -1 && errno == ECHILD);
}
printf("PASS posix_spawn()\n");
printf("PASS posix_spawnp()\n");
return (0);
}
